Press release date: February 11, 2008

SEATTLE, Feb. 11 - Onvia (NASDAQ:ONVI), a leading provider of comprehensive sales intelligence, today announced it has broadly expanded its solutions for the construction industry by delivering hard-to-find information on emerging commercial and residential projects nationwide.

Unlike the government purchase opportunities Onvia has traditionally offered, commercial and residential projects typically start out below the radar.

"The new Onvia service eliminates the need to manually search public records," said Mike Pickett, CEO. "Onvia now notifies architects, engineers, contractors and suppliers about early-stage projects, including industrial parks, condos, retail developments and assisted-living facilities, in time for clients to build relationships with decision makers and potential partners."

One of the first companies to sign up for the new service was Long Span Bridge & Culvert, which designs and builds bridge and culvert systems nationwide. Long Span is a division of Lane Enterprises, both headquartered in Camp Hill, Penn.

"Private-sector projects are hard to find, and we need to learn about them as early as possible if we want to be part of the project team and get our systems specified," said Kevin McKee, PE, head of operations at Long Span. "The new Onvia service showed me projects I didn't know about and linked them to data on developers and engineers I need to meet. To have all that information available can change the way Long Span develops business."

"Clients have told us the new Onvia service plugs a major information gap in the industry," said Pickett. "By enlarging the pool of known opportunities, we can help clients sustain revenue growth in a slowing construction market."

About Onvia

Onvia (NASDAQ:ONVI) helps businesses achieve a competitive advantage by delivering timely and actionable sales opportunities and information. More than 8,800 subscribers across the United States rely on Onvia as a comprehensive resource for industry-specific information needed to make intelligent sales decisions. Onvia offers unparalleled coverage of government purchasing activity in addition to commercial and residential projects in development for markets such as architecture and engineering, IT/telecom, business consulting services, operations and maintenance, and transportation. Onvia was founded in 1996 and is headquartered in Seattle, Washington.
